Composing a Official Intimation for Cheque Bounce : Key Points

When handling a cheque return, crafting a appropriate legal intimation is essential . Meticulous drafting requires attention to numerous elements. The letter website must plainly state the amount of the cheque, the date it was drawn, the lender involved, and the cause for the return. It's necessary to specify the relevant sections of the Transferable Instruments Act or the Reserve Bank of India 's regulations. Furthermore , ensuring the communication is sent via certified post with acknowledgment is extremely advised for verification of delivery. Finally, regularly consult advice from a legal professional to guarantee compliance with local statutes.
